IP Country City ISP
178.162.173.89 Netherlands LeaseWeb Netherlands B.V.
185.237.216.30
213.152.187.225 Netherlands Global Layer B.V.
223.72.70.28 China Beijing China Mobile Guangdong
23.162.8.81
31.200.249.237 Russia Start LLC
84.40.223.224 Poland Netia SA